The Chemistry of Emulsification
When you blend oil and water, you could see they don't blend easily; that's where the chemistry of emulsification comes right into play. To overcome this difficulty, emulsifiers are used.
These particles have a hydrophilic (water-attracting) head and a hydrophobic (water-repelling) tail. When you add an emulsifier, its particles position themselves at the oil-water interface, decreasing surface area stress and permitting the beads to mix. The emulsifier develops a safety layer around each droplet, avoiding them from coalescing back right into different layers. Comprehending this chemistry is essential for achieving security in items like dressings, creams, and sauces, making emulsification crucial in contemporary production.

Systems of Emulsion Formation
Understanding exactly how emulsions create is crucial for developing secure blends of oil and water. Solutions take place when you spread tiny droplets of one liquid into an additional immiscible liquid, such as oil in water. This procedure calls for power, typically supplied via frustration or mixing. When you present an emulsifier, it lowers the surface tension between both fluids, allowing them to blend more quickly.
The emulsifier molecules have a hydrophilic (water-attracting) head and a hydrophobic (oil-attracting) tail. When you include an emulsifier, these molecules arrange themselves at the oil-water interface. The hydrophilic heads connect with water, while the hydrophobic tails anchor into the oil. This produces an obstacle that stabilizes the droplets, preventing them from coalescing.
